Pagini recente » Cod sursa (job #2480773) | Cod sursa (job #1354349) | Cod sursa (job #3225195) | Cod sursa (job #2322575) | Cod sursa (job #2748251)
#include<fstream>
#include<map>
using namespace std;
using namespace __gnu_cxx;
ifstream f("hashuri.in");
ofstream g("hashuri.out");
int N;
hash_set< int, hash<int> > H;
void solve()
{
int op,x;
for( f>>N; N; --N )
{
f>>op>>x;
switch( op )
{
case 1 : H.insert(x); break;
case 2 : H.erase(x); break;
case 3 : g<< ( H.find(x)!=H.end() ) <<"\n";
}
}
}
int main()
{
solve();
return 0;